Historical shift: Bitcoin difficulty increases while Hashrate withdraws from the Zettahash rangeAfter exceeding the threshold of 1 zettahash per second (ZH / S), the mining difficulty of Bitcoin climbed 4.89% to reach a summum of 136.04 Billions. This adjustment, associated with ramolli bitcoin prices, has tightened the compression of mining participants.
